Personal Diary of Zann Darkiron, High Priest of Os Searchcastle the Absolute Power
1st of Opal, year 128
Tonight...was strange. I swear, I was given a vision by Os Searchcastle - it was too...lucid, too real, to have been a mere dream.

It would be impossible for me to describe it in detail, it was beyond comprehension - however, when I woke up, it was as though I understood everything - the dwarven clans must be destroyed. Dwarvenkind has suffered enough throughout its history - if the constant raids from goblin scum weren't enough, the clan leaders are also more interested in seeing who can claim more land and steal the most riches. They all must be wiped out.


If the other dwarves knew what I'm about to do, they would have me killed, for sure...So, I'm enlisting the aid of some human mercenaries instead. They'll do anything as long as the pay is good, and I have more than enough gold to pay them off.

Even with their help, it would not be enough to take on the clans head-on. No, I must devise a plan. I shall build an outpost, recruit more followers. Then, I shall attempt to cause open war between the two clans - once one clan destroys the other, my own followers will strike down what remains of the remaining, weakened one.
2nd of Opal, 128
I found a great spot near the elven forest retreat of Clubsung - plenty of trees for lumber, lots of wildlife to hunt for food. The only problem is the arrogant wretches nearby. If they notice their beloved trees going missing, they might try to start a fight with us. Elves aren't particularly known for their advanced weaponry, however it would still be prudent to strike at them before they can try to stop us.
27th of Opal, 128

It is finally done - after several weeks of hard labour, we managed to build a small outpost. I do have plans to eventually expand it, in preparation for new recruits. Regardless, for now I will have to preemptively strike at the elves in Clubsung - the lack of reaction in the past few weeks is troubling.



This was...definitely not expected. The forest retreat was almost devoid of actual elves - only stray animals remained. An unholy abomination was seeking to make them, and us, it's meal. The brute actually knocked over a tree some of the animals were hiding on!

I almost didn't notice it turning it's attention to us, due to the dust - it tried to bite me in the head, and while I avoided most of the damage, the brute still hit me in the teeth with its head. I'll take a few missing teeth over being dead.

I hacked at the abberation with my axe - the beast was surprisingly fast for it's size. It managed to strike at my foot hard enough to knock me over - I thought I was going to die there.

Os Searchcastle had me in His grace, however, and sent forth a guardian to distract the wretch - it must have been quite a strong hit, for the creature fell over, having seemingly lost control of its leg.

It still flailed around, managing to bend one of the human hireling's legs at an unnatural angle - I took this opportunity to hack at it's neck, with the blow leaving my axe stuck in the wound. It appeared that at this point the freak's body went almost completely limp - it was still struggling for breath, making a ghastly gasping noise.

I struck the beast once more, this time in the head, and completely split it in twain. I felt relief, not only having smitten a servant of evil, thus proving my worth to eternal, glorious Os, but also because I knew I wouldn't have to deal with the elves anytime soon.

At that point, we returned to our outpost. It was time to rest - I shall continue my sacred mission once I recover my strength.

1st of Obsidian, 128


I've recruited more mercenaries and expanded the dormitories. Our force is sizable enough to defend the outpost properly, should anything go wrong - it is time to finally embark on our mission.
3rd of Obsidian, 128

The mercenaries waited while I snuck into one of the clan dwellings - Inktrenches, it was called.


I snuck up to an official-looking dwarf, and I chopped one of his feet off so he wouldn't be able to run. Then I decapitated him, and tore a scrap out of my own clothing, which bore the insignia of Northhope the First Citadel - my former home. Left it near the body - once the other members of this clan find the cloth scrap near the dwarf's dead body, it should be enough to draw them into conflict with the other clan - perhaps it would be enough to sow distrust and dissent among the dwarves of Odur Okir, who tried to improve their relations with Northhope, shortly before I left.

I took some of the dead dwarf's clothing, and put it on. Only one thing left to do.
4th of Obsidian, 128
We reached Northhope at night. Once again, I told the mercenaries to wait for me outside.

It appeared most of the dwarves here were asleep and inside the citadel itself, which was locked - for whatever reason, a little girl was outside at this hour, playing alone in the snow.

As much as I didn't want to, some...force, beyond my control...compelled me to decapitate her - may Os forgive me for this grave sin, but it must have been done. I eventually regained my composure and left the tattered scrap of cloth I took from Inktrenches noble near the child's body.

I left for my outpost, still in disbelief over what I've done. But...it is a burden I must bear, if dwarvenkind is to regain it's strength and dignity. The only thing I can do for now is wait and see what comes of all this.
